In a move to accelerate innovation in modern warfare capabilities, Swedish defence giant Saab has entered into a formal partnership with the Kyiv School of Economics (KSE). The agreement targets two pivotal technological domains: Unmanned Aerial Systems (UAVs) and microelectronics, sectors that are rapidly redefining the landscape of global security.
This long-term collaboration is designed to bridge the gap between theoretical research and real-world military application. By establishing a framework for joint projects, student exchanges, and experimental development, the partnership aims to fast-track the creation of next-generation defence and dual-use technologies. The initiative underscores a mutual commitment to bolstering technological resilience in an era marked by complex and evolving threats.
Anders Carp, Deputy CEO of Saab, emphasized the strategic value of the alliance. “This partnership opens a direct window into the future of defence,” Carp stated. “By collaborating with KSE, we are not only expanding our global research footprint but also gaining invaluable insights into the practical, cutting-edge applications of UAVs and microelectronics being developed in a high-demand environment. We are eager to merge our system-level expertise with their fresh, applied research.”
From the academic perspective, the collaboration validates a new model of engineering education. Tymofii Brik, Rector of KSE, explained, “Our institution was founded on the principle of combining rigorous academic training with immediate, real-world problem-solving. Partnering with a global leader like Saab ensures our research in UAVs and microelectronics is directly aligned with operational needs. It’s a powerful feedback loop: our students and researchers tackle present-day challenges, and their work informs the future of defence systems.”
KSE brings to the table a unique, frontline-informed perspective on technological challenges, particularly in UAV warfare and resilient microelectronics. Saab provides the industrial scale and deep systems knowledge required to integrate these academic breakthroughs into operational platforms. The ultimate goal of the partnership is a symbiotic one: to accelerate innovation cycles, cultivate a new generation of defence tech experts, and translate cutting-edge academic research into tangible, system-level solutions for the battlefield of tomorrow.
